TSPGECET 2024 Update on 2nd phase Counseling and it's Eligibility Criteria

1. Next round of counselling for left over seats in phase-I, seats of not reported cases and new seats sanctioned, if any, will be conducted. The date of phase-II counselling shall be notified for the left-over seats and new seats, if any, sanctioned. 2. Who should participate in Phase-II counseling? a. Who secures a seat in earlier phase of web-based counselling and wish to move to some other college. b. Candidates who participated in earlier phase of web-based counselling and could not secure a seat. c. Candidates who did not participate in earlier phase even though he / she has been called for counselling. d. Candidates who were allotted a seat but didn’t report. e. A candidate allotted a seat in the earlier phase but cancelled his / her admission. 23. The candidates may note that a. Options Exercised for one phase will not be considered for other phase of counselling. b. Candidates must exercise options afresh for each phase of web-based counselling. c. In case if they are satisfied with the previous allotment, options need not be exercised again. d. Options may be exercised for those colleges even if the vacancies are not available, as vacancies may arise due to sliding, cancellation and conversions. 24. If the candidate secures a seat in phase-II, he / she will lose the claim on the earlier allotted college and has to report to the new college on or before the specified date. Failing to report within the last date in the allotted college, the candidate will forfeit the claim on the new college as well as on the old college.
